Steve Rutherford authored
commit ac3f9c9f upstream. enc_dec_hypercall() accepted a page count instead of a size, which forced its callers to round up. As a result, non-page aligned vaddrs caused pages to be spuriously marked as decrypted via the encryption status hypercall, which in turn caused consistent corruption of pages during live migration. Live migration requires accurate encryption status information to avoid migrating pages from the wrong perspective. Alexander Aring authored
commit 7c53e847 upstream. All posix lock ops, for all lockspaces (gfs2 file systems) are sent to userspace (dlm_controld) through a single misc device. The dlm_controld daemon reads the ops from the misc device and sends them to other cluster nodes using separate, per-lockspace cluster api communication channels. The ops for a single lockspace are ordered at this level, so that the results are received in the same sequence that the requests were sent. When the results are sent back to the kernel via the misc device, they are again funneled through the single misc device for all lockspaces. When the dlm code in the kernel processes the results from the misc device, these results will be returned in the same sequence that the requests were sent, on a per-lockspace basis. A recent change in this request/reply matching code missed the "per-lockspace" check (fsid comparison) when matching request and reply, so replies could be incorrectly matched to requests from other lockspaces. Feiyang Chen authored
commit 5694ba13 upstream. For a device with no Power Management Capability, pci_power_up() previously returned 0 (success) if the platform was able to put the device in D0, which led to pci_set_full_power_state() trying to read PCI_PM_CTRL, even though it doesn't exist. Since dev->pm_cap == 0 in this case, pci_set_full_power_state() actually read the wrong register, interpreted it as PCI_PM_CTRL, and corrupted dev->current_state. This led to messages like this in some cases: pci 0000:01:00.0: Refused to change power state from D3hot to D0 To prevent this, make pci_power_up() always return a negative failure code if the device lacks a Power Management Capability, even if non-PCI platform power management has been able to put the device in D0. The failure will prevent pci_set_full_power_state() from trying to access PCI_PM_CTRL. Ranjan Kumar authored
commit 4ca10f3e upstream. The driver retries certain register reads 3 times if the returned value is 0. This was done because the controller could return 0 for certain registers if other registers were being accessed concurrently by the BMC. In certain systems with increased BMC interactions, the register values returned can be 0 for longer than 3 retries. Change the retry count from 3 to 30 for the affected registers to prevent problems with out-of-band management. Srinivas Pandruvada authored
commit 081690e9 upstream. System runs at minimum performance, once powercap RAPL package domain enabled flag is changed from 1 to 0 to 1. Setting RAPL package domain enabled flag to 0, results in setting of power limit 4 (PL4) MSR 0x601 to 0. This implies disabling PL4 limit. The PL4 limit controls the peak power. So setting 0, results in some undesirable performance, which depends on hardware implementation. Even worse, when the enabled flag is set to 1 again. This will set PL4 MSR value to 0x01, which means reduce peak power to 0.125W. This will force system to run at the lowest possible performance on every PL4 supported system. Setting enabled flag should only affect the "enable" bit, not other bits. Here it is changing power limit. This is caused by a change which assumes that there is an enable bit in the PL4 MSR like other power limits. Although PL4 enable/disable bit is present with TPMI RAPL interface, it is not present with the MSR interface. There is a rapl_primitive_info defined for non existent PL4 enable bit and then it is used with the commit 9050a9cd ("powercap: intel_rapl: Cleanup Power Limits support") to enable PL4. This is wrong, hence remove this rapl primitive for PL4. Also in the function rapl_detect_powerlimit(), PL_ENABLE is used to check for the presence of power limits. Replace PL_ENABLE with PL_LIMIT, as PL_LIMIT must be present. Without this change, PL4 controls will not be available in the sysfs once rapl primitive for PL4 is removed.
